From: Schwann cells promote prevascularization and osteogenesis of tissue-engineered bone via bone marrow mesenchymal stem cell-derived endothelial cells

Fig. 1

Cell culture and identification. a SCs at passage 2. b–f S100 (b), GFAP (c), SOX10 (d), MPZ (e), and GAP43 (f) immunocytochemical or immunofluorescence staining of SCs. g AECs at passage 2. h Factor VIII immunocytochemical staining of AECs. i Pecam-1 immunofluorescence staining of AECs. j vWF immunofluorescence staining of AECs. k BM-MSCs at passage 3. l IECs after induction for 21 days. m–o Flow cytometric detection of CD90 (m), CD29 (n), and CD73 (o) on IEC membrane (blue: isotype negative control, red: IECs). p TEM image of BM-MSCs (× 6610). q TEM image of IECs after induction for 21 days (× 5200). r CD34, Kdr, Nos2, and Nos3 mRNA expression levels in BM-MSCs and IECs, as assessed via real-time qPCR. s Pecam-1 immunofluorescence staining of IECs. t vWF immunofluorescence staining of IECs. u, v ALP (u) and alizarin red S (v) staining of IOBs after induction for 21 days
